when i open start.bat, even i downloaded java, it says 'javaw' is not found in Windows, and it ask me to make sure the name is correct

Yes, I've had this issue as well ... what you need to do is copy javaw file into the rpgeditor folder ... easiest way I've found is by doing search on computer (search box usually somewhere after clicking "start" button or "Windows" or similar, depending on os) .. anyway, search for "javaw", right click and "open file location", then copy and paste the javaw file into the rpgeditor folder and try again ....
